It seems #331 has been fixed (if I recall correctly, this only affected the reading of RNO-G files, which seems to work again now according to the tests), and, with the release of numpy 2.0 (which is not compatible with older versions of awkward/uproot), I think we should unpin uproot and awkward again so that everyone can use the latest version of numpy.
